In John chapter one, first of all, we want to say, Jesus always did the will of God. That's an important thing to understand. Jesus always did the will of God. See, you and I sometimes we do our own thing, right? 'Cause we're born and sinned. The Bible says all have sinned and comes short of the glory of God. All of us, me, you, everybody, have done things in our lives that were our idea. We really did our own thing, right? And even sometimes when God is telling us what to do and what to watch out for, you know, from His word or in our prayer time, God will sometimes tell you, watch that over there, don't go there, don't do that thing, what do we do? We go ahead and we do it anyway, right? Because we're human beings. Sometimes we just, you know, we do what we want to do. And sometimes we ignore that still small voice that's trying to warn us, you know? But Jesus never did that. Jesus always, always, always did the will of God. John chapter one, verse one says, "In the beginning was the Word." And the Word was with God and the Word was God. So the Bible is telling us that in the beginning there was God and there was the Word. Now that Word is Jesus Christ. And we're gonna see that in just a second. But the Bible is letting us know that God, there was God and there was the Word. And the Word was with God, so it was alongside Him. But the Word also was God. They're one and the same. They are not separate. They are separate, but they are the same. It's kind of hard for us to understand, but it's one of those things that we have to kind of, except by faith, amen, you know? And then verse 14 says, "The Word was made flesh and dwelt among us." So that's Jesus, see? Because He was the God man, right? He was God made flesh dwelling among us. So that's how we know that the Word is talking about Jesus Himself. And we beheld His glory. The glory as of the only begotten of the Father full of grace and truth. Now what does it mean when it says we beheld His glory? The glory as of the only begotten of the Father. What does it mean by that? Well, that's talking about healing. Every time Jesus healed somebody, He was demonstrating the power and the glory of God, amen? What He was doing was He was demonstrating not only that He was God by laying hands on the sick and the sick being healed, but that God was with Him and that He was doing what God had sent Him to do, amen? So that's what this is talking about. Then we can go to John 829. Jesus said these words, "He that sent me," He's talking about God the Father, "is with me. The Father has not left me alone." Because why? Because I do always those things that please Him. Aha, so see here Jesus is telling us out of His own mouth, "I always do what pleases my Father." You see, so Jesus always, always, always did the will of His Father. He said, "The Father is with me. He has not left me alone." So the Father never left Him alone, amen. So now we come to Matthew 8 verses one through three. Now, to give you a little background before Matthew 8 in verses at least verses five through seven, and I think maybe even part of verse four, Jesus did a lot of talking. For you who have a red letter edition of the Bible, you'll see that those particular chapters, Matthew 5, Matthew 6, and Matthew 7, are all in red letters because it's all Jesus' words. It was Him talking, it was the Sermon on the Mount. So Jesus did a lot of talking. He did a lot of teaching, you see, in these verses. And verse seven actually ends by saying that the multitudes were astounded at the words that were coming out of His mouth because He taught as one that had authority. He taught as one that had power. You see, they had never heard anybody preach and teach the way Jesus did, amen? So hearing the words of Christ, they realized this man's got something different. This man has power behind his words, you see. And so when he was calmed down from the mountain in Matthew 8, verse one, great multitudes followed him. So they heard his teaching, now they were following him. See, why? Because the words of Christ inspire faith. They cause faith to well up inside of us, you see. We're talking about the necessity of faith. The words of Christ inspired them. The words of Christ caused their faith to grow strong, you see. It puts you on a high in the spirit, as it were, you see. And it causes you to want to hear more. It causes you to want to follow Jesus. It causes you to want to get in that prayer closet. Your private time with God. And just spend hours spending time with Jesus, amen? And so they followed him. And behold, there came a leper and worshiped him saying, "Lord, if you will, you can make me clean." Now this leper was not with the multitudes that were following Jesus out of the mountain. The reason was because he had leprosy. And back in that day in time, lepers were not allowed to hang out or be with the rest of the people, the people that didn't have leprosy because they had leprosy. They could pass it along, you see, it was contagious. So they had to be apart. And that's what this man did. He was respecting the customs and traditions of his time, you see, by keeping himself separate and staying apart. But when Jesus came down, he said, "Lord, if you will, you can make me clean." Now the leper wasn't with the multitudes that were up on the top of the mountain. But it's very possible that he might have been able to hear some of what Jesus was teaching, amen? And he might have been able to hear the words that Jesus was speaking. And hear the authority and the power behind his voice. So I have a feeling that that might have been one of the reasons why this leper had faith to believe for his healing, you see? Because he heard the words of Jesus and he said, "You know what? I can be healed." So there was no question in this leper's mind whatsoever that Jesus could heal him of his leprosy. But there was only one question that he still had. And he voiced it. He said, "If you will, you can make me clean." Now see, he didn't have the Bible like we have it today. He didn't understand. So he was speaking out of his own understanding which was kind of limited, you see. So he didn't realize that it was the will of God to heal. He knew that Jesus could do it. He didn't have any doubt about that. But did he want to do it? Was it his will to do it? Listen to what Jesus told this man. Jesus put forth his hand and touched him. Oh my God. What a move of compassion. Amen? For Jesus who is clean, you know, he doesn't have any leprosy or anything like that, to reach out his hand and touch this man, this man with leprosy, this man who is unclean, this man who is dirty and filthy. Jesus didn't tell him, "Oh, you need to go get yourself cleaned up or something, sir, before I put my hands on you." No, no, no, no, no. Jesus reached out his hand and touched him right then and there. And he said, "I will be thou clean." And immediately, his leprosy was cleansed. See, Jesus was answering through this man once and for all. The question, is it God's will to heal? Acts 1038 says how God anointed Jesus of Nazareth with the Holy Ghost and with power. Who Jesus went about doing good and healing how many? All that were oppressed of the devil. For God was with him. Remember, we said, Jesus said God is with me. He has not left me alone because I always do the will of my Father. I always do what pleases him. So if Jesus always does what pleases the Father and he heals all who were oppressed of the devil, in other words, all who are sick 'cause sickness is an oppression of the devil. Sickness does not come from God. You see, God never makes anybody sick. Amen? So you could just, you know, some people they say, well, God must be trying to teach me something 'cause he put this sickness on me. No, no, no, no, no, no, no, no. God never makes anybody sick. God makes people well. God is in a healing business. He doesn't put sicknesses on people. He may allow you to go through it for a time but God's will is always to heal.
